Choosing the right gas grill involves several key considerations to match your culinary needs and lifestyle. Before selecting a gas grill, consider the type of gas—propane offers portability while natural gas requires a fixed location but provides continuous fuel. The number of burners affects cooking capacity and flexibility, ranging from single for simplicity to six for large gatherings. Special burners like flame side, infrared side or rear, and sear burners add versatility, allowing for a range of cooking techniques. Options like a griddle or rotisserie kit further enhance culinary possibilities. Lastly, consider portability if you plan to move the grill or cook in different locations.

The infrared rear burner is typically used in conjunction with a rotisserie kit. Mounted at the back of the grill, it provides consistent, intense heat that cooks food evenly on all sides. This burner is perfect for slow-roasting meats, ensuring juicy, tender results with a crisp outer layer. It's a favorite feature for those who enjoy gourmet grilling and the taste of perfectly roasted poultry or roasts.
